Radiohead and Kings Of Leon join Arctic Monkeys as headliners of Reading and Leeds Festival 2009. Prodigy, Kaiser Chiefs, Bloc Party all get second billing across the three days from Friady 28 to Sunday 30 August. Other bands added to the lineup include Placebo, Maximo Park, Yeah Yeah Yeahs, Fall Out Boy, Vampire Weekend, Ian Brown, Funeral For A Friend, Gossip, Glasvegas, White Lies, Florence & The Machine, Friendly Fires and Gallows. Oasis and The Killers are set to headline Virgin Media’s V Festival in Chelmsford and Staffordshire on 22 & 23 August. Fatboy Slim, Keane, The Specials, Elbow, Pendulum, The Tings Tings, MGMT and Lady Ga Ga will also be playing at what will be the V Festival’s fourteenth year. The Virgin Mobile Union stage sees lyrical genius Peter Doherty take to the stage and will be joined by a load of other acts to be announced in the coming weeks. Tickets go on sale at 10am on Friday. Don’t miss your chance to see rock royalty in Sydney this week when Alice In Chains take to the Enmore Theatre stage on Wednesday 25th Feburary. After a long hiatus, the members of Alice In Chains have decided to honour their musical legacy by taking their beloved songs to the road. Jerry Cantrell, Mike Inez and Sean Kinney will be joined by William Duvall on lead vocals who fills the void left after the tragic 2002 death of the legendary Layne Staley. This year the band are thrilled to be reunited and returning to the music they created and the legacy that is Alice In Chains.
